Johari, Mohd Hafiz, Khairil Anwar Abu Kassim, Yahaya Ahmad, Najihah Wahi, Nor Kamaliana Khamis, and Mohd Radzi Abu Mansor. "Safety Levels and Occupant Injury Risk for Light Commercial Vehicles in the ASEAN Region: Results of Crashworthiness Data." Jurnal Kejuruteraan 33, no. 4 (2021): 955–67. http://dx.doi.org/10.17576/jkukm-2021-33(4)-18.

Full text
Abstract:
The logistics industry in Malaysia has greatly evolved in recent years. With regard to the freight industry, business operations depend on transportation service using commercial vehicles to deliver products in a timely manner. Technically categorised as N1 vehicle, the Light Commercial Vehicle (LCV) or light duty truck is designed to carry goods with maximum load not exceeding 3.5 tons. To maximize cargo size, the occupant cabin space has been pushed forward, hence, becoming a ‘flat head type’ vehicle. Kugler, Kholofelo. "Russia – Anti-Dumping Duties on Light Commercial Vehicles from Germany (Russia–Commercial Vehicles) (DS479)." World Trade Review 17, no. 4 (2018): 696–700. http://dx.doi.org/10.1017/s1474745618000319.

Full text
Abstract:
The dispute relates to anti-dumping duties imposed by Russia on certain light commercial vehicles (LCVs) from Germany and Italy. These anti-dumping duties were applied pursuant to Decision No. 113 of 14 May 2013 of the Board of the Eurasian Economic Commission (EEC), including the relevant annexes, notices, and reports of the Department for Internal Market Defence of the EEC (DIMD).
